Amontada, like a local
Don't miss
- Praia de Amontada: The most popular beach, known for its stunning scenery and vibrant atmosphere.
- Igreja Matriz de São José: A charming historic church with beautiful architecture.
- Caminho das Dunas: A lesser-known trail offering breathtaking views of dunes and lagoons.
- Praia da Barra do Mundaú: A hidden gem with tranquil waters, perfect for relaxation.
Where to eat
- Restaurante do Júnior: Famous for its seafood dishes, particularly the local fish stew.
- Pizzaria e Lanchonete Juca: Offers delicious pizzas and local snacks that are loved by locals.
- Sorveteria Amontada: Known for its artisanal ice creams made from local fruits.
Do this
- Kite Surfing Lessons: Amontada is a top destination for kite surfing due to its favorable winds.
- Local Cultural Festival: Experience the vibrant local culture and traditions celebrated annually.
- Fishing Trip: Join local fishermen for an authentic fishing experience in the area.
Local tips
- Visit the local markets for fresh fruits and handmade crafts.
- Try the 'caldinho de feijão' at street vendors for an authentic snack.
- Early mornings are the best time to enjoy the beach with fewer crowds.
- Learn a few basic Portuguese phrases; locals appreciate the effort.
Know before you go
Best time
May to September. During this period, the weather is warm and dry, ideal for outdoor activities and enjoying the beaches.
Getting around
Public buses and local taxis are common; renting a bike is also popular for short distances.

Language
Portuguese is the main language spoken.
Money
Brazilian Real (BRL). Credit and debit cards are widely accepted, but it's advisable to carry cash for small purchases.
Safety
Amontada is generally safe for tourists, but it's advisable to stay aware of your surroundings and avoid isolated areas at night.
